The Payden High Income Fund invests in global growth companies whose high-yield bonds yield a premium to US Treasury bonds. The fund invests in the higher quality segment of the market and looks for companies with superior management teams and value-added products.




Appropriate for investors who seek higher yields and diversification in the growing high-yield bond market.




  • Potential for capital appreciation
  • Focuses on upper-tier high-yield bonds and employs strong risk controls
  • Portfolio diversification tool
